
MANILA — The Philippine Stock Exchange Index (PSEi) closed lower on Tuesday, dropping 1.57 percent, or 96.24 points, to 6,037.17, pulling back below the 6,100 level. Investors remained on the defensive amid persistent geopolitical risks abroad and a softening domestic economic outlook.
